Re: Deleted emails

If you're using outlook express, you can set your final delete function several ways.<br /><br />one it goes to the delete folder and stays until you 'final' delete it.<br /><br />two you set your delete folder to 'final' delete on exit of outlook express.<br /><br />three you set the delete function up so that when you delete it is gone immediately. None of them go to the trash bin.<br /><br />You can check your settings in the 'maintanance tab' in 'options' in the tools button. I think default is that it just goes to the delete folder till you final delete it. It will always give a warning before final delete.

If it is a web based email, like yahoo, hotmail etc., once you send it your delete folder, the server comes thru, at some inteval, and does the final delete for you. If you had just sent it there by accident, you usually have enough time to scavange back out before the come thru for the clean sweep of your delete folder.<br /><br />If you want to prevent that from happening, make a new folder, call it Semi-Delete, and move email from your inbox to that folder. Created folders usually store the mail on your hard drive and whatever you put in one will stay there until you delete it.
